Devanagari is a complex script where characters combine to form conjuncts (e.g., क + ् + त = क्त). The "Trilochan-Normal" variant is optimized to render these conjuncts without overlapping or clipping. Unlike basic system fonts that sometimes break in older software, this TTF file contains specific glyph substitution tables.

Unlike modern Unicode fonts that often prioritize geometric uniformity, Trilochan-Normal has a distinct "calligraphic" or "hand-written" feel. The characters possess a slight slant and varying stroke widths that mimic the flow of a traditional pen or ink brush. This gives the text a warm, organic, and artistic aesthetic, making it highly legible and visually appealing in printed materials.
